Early Life and Background

Gennady Tatarinov was born on April 20, 1991, in Kopeysk, a small town in the Chelyabinsk Oblast region of Russia. From a young age, he showed a natural talent for cycling and quickly became passionate about the sport. Growing up in a region known for its rugged terrain and challenging weather conditions, Tatarinov developed a strong work ethic and determination that would serve him well in his future cycling career.
